What's the recommended time of year for hiking Mount Kenya considering weather conditions?
December to March and June to October offer the most reliable conditions for hiking Mount Kenya. During these dry seasons the trails stay firm and visibility remains good throughout the routes. The Chogoria route benefits from its position on the mountain's drier side making it especially suitable during these months. The Sirimon route located on the northwestern side stays accessible through all seasons. What type of accommodation can I expect during a Mount Kenya trek?
Mount Kenya treks provide a range of sleeping options from mountain huts to organized campsites at various elevations. The Sirimon route features stops at Old Moses Camp (3300m) and Shipton Camp (4200m). Along the Chogoria route travelers rest at Meru Mount Kenya Bandas and Mintos Hut. How long does it take to climb Mount Kenya and what's the best route for acclimatization?
Mount Kenya climbs usually take 4-6 days with the Sirimon-Chogoria combination providing the best altitude adaptation. Reaching Point Lenana (4985m) typically requires 2-3 days of hiking with daily treks lasting 4-7 hours covering 9-14 kilometers. The Sirimon route starts at 2600m ascending gradually to Old Moses Camp (3300m) then Shipton Camp (4200m). How physically demanding are Kenya's hiking tours?
The physical demands of Kenya's hikes range from easy day walks to strenuous multi-day expeditions. The Point Lenana trek requires 6-7 hours of daily hiking covering 9-14km with elevation gains between 400-900m each day. Routes like Naro Moru include challenging vertical bog sections while Sirimon offers more moderate inclines. What wildlife might I encounter during a Kenya hiking tour?
Mount Kenya's trails offer chances to spot elephants black-and-white colobus monkeys Cape buffalos and numerous bird species. Wildlife viewing peaks in the lower rainforest and bamboo zones. Nearby areas like Ol Pejeta Conservancy expand wildlife spotting opportunities.
